How Residential Water Testing Actually Works
So, how does residential water testing work? In essence, it involves collecting a water sample from your home's plumbing system and sending it to a certified laboratory for analysis. The laboratory then tests the sample for a range of parameters, including pH levels, total dissolved solids, and contaminants like lead, bacteria, and viruses. The results provide a comprehensive picture of your water quality, allowing you to identify potential issues and take steps to address them.

What types of contaminants can residential water testing detect?
Residential water testing can detect a wide range of contaminants, including lead, mercury, arsenic, and other heavy metals, as well as bacteria, viruses, and other microorganisms.

The frequency of residential water testing depends on various factors, including your home's age, location, and plumbing system. Typically, it's recommended to test your water every 6-12 months.
Can I conduct residential water testing myself?
While there are DIY kits available for residential water testing, it's generally recommended to have a certified laboratory conduct the analysis to ensure accurate and reliable results.
What if I find contaminants in my water?
If you find contaminants in your water, it's essential to take steps to address the issue promptly. This may involve installing a water filter, rerouting your plumbing system, or seeking professional help from a water treatment expert.
